¿Qué significa "Lista de Adyacencia"?
Tabla de contenidos
Una lista de adyacencia es una forma de representar un grafo usando un formato de lista. En esta estructura, cada nodo (o punto) en el grafo tiene una lista de nodos a los que está directamente conectado. Esto significa que puedes ver rápidamente cuáles son los nodos vecinos o que están enlazados entre sí.
Por ejemplo, si tienes un grafo que muestra amigos en una red social, cada persona tendría una lista de sus amigos. Si Alice es amiga de Bob y Charlie, la lista de adyacencia de Alice incluiría a Bob y Charlie.
Esta representación es eficiente porque usa menos memoria, especialmente cuando el grafo es grande pero tiene muchos nodos que no están conectados entre sí. También facilita agregar o eliminar conexiones entre nodos, lo cual es útil cuando el grafo cambia a menudo.
En resumen, las listas de adyacencia son una forma simple y efectiva de mostrar cómo se conectan los nodos en un grafo.